Many businesses cannot open on these days unless they have obtained ...The spreads between the prices a retail trader sees in bid-ask quotes and the market price go to the market makers. MMs move fast and can buy and sell in bulk ahead of everyone else. This helps the flow of trading when things get stuck. Retail traders in forex are individuals who trade in the foreign exchange market for their own account, rather than on behalf of an institution or company. These traders are often referred to as “retail forex traders” or simply “retail traders.”.
